Free Online Course: Blender 2.91 Essential Training provided by LinkedIn Learning is a comprehensive online course, which lasts for 4-5 hours worth of material. The course is taught in English and is free of charge. Upon completion of the course, you can receive an e-certificate from LinkedIn Learning. Blender 2.91 Essential Training is taught by David Andrade.

Overview
  • Get up and running with Blender 2.91, the powerful open-source tool for 2D and 3D modeling, animation, compositing, and post-production.
